Sachio Sakai (堺 左千夫, Sakai Sachio, September 8, 1925 - March 11, 1998), real name Yukio Abe (阿部 幸男, Abe Yukio), was a Japanese actor. Sakai was the son of an electrician and later graduated from Tokyo City Asakusa Technical College. In 1946, Sakai entered and passed the first Toho New Face program and had his first film appearance under the studio in 1947 in Akira Kurosawa's "One Wonderful Sunday". Sakai would go on to appear in numerous films by the studio, including many directed by Kurosawa, Kihachi Okamoto, and Ishiro Honda.
